Configure Servicer Settings for Campuses
You can use Servicer tab to configure the servicer used by your institution. If your institution uses Global Financial Services for processing financial aid, use this feature to provide Anthology Student with some of the necessary setup information. Once you have configured your servicer, Anthology Student updates the student's document list when an SD file is imported from Global. The student's Document Folder has a current record of the status of each document required by Global for Title IV financial aid.

Note: When Anthology Student is configured to use a servicer, users have the option to include or exclude remedial coursework within the Academic Extract. Users can identify and configure which remedial courses need to be included for a student within the cumulative credit hours (which determines the grade level). The main configuration is done on the program version level and is used to populate the flag on the remedial courses as they are added to the student's course list. The flag can be changed at the student level. Academic Extracts will use the setting from each student's individual courses.
